Hey Duct_tape123 would you recommend using shallow mount woofers with that box?
I've got a pair of Rockford Fosgate P3s in the upper box. 1.73 cubic feet with just over 5.75" mounting depth. If the sub doesn't have a wide magnet you could squeeze a 6"+ sub in there. The lower box is 1.23 cubic feet with the same mounting depth but it has a 'recessed' area for my Rockford Fosgate Power1000 5 channel amp. If you can run a full depth sub, do it. You will be much happier with the output.
